Understanding Kodiak Crab

Kodiak crabs, also known as Alaskan king crabs or red king crabs, are a popular seafood delicacy known for their large size and delicious meat. These crabs are commonly found in the cold waters of the North Pacific Ocean, particularly around the Kodiak Island in Alaska.

Kodiak crabs are renowned for their impressive size, with adults often measuring up to 6 feet in length and weighing around 10 to 20 pounds. They have a distinctive reddish-brown color and powerful claws that they use for hunting and protection. These crabs are highly sought after for their succulent and flavorful meat, which is considered a delicacy in many cuisines.

One of the key reasons for the popularity of Kodiak crabs is their rich and sweet flavor. The meat is tender and has a slightly salty taste, making it perfect for a variety of dishes ranging from crab cakes to chowders. Kodiak crabs are typically harvested during the winter months when they migrate to shallower waters to reproduce.

The sustainability and management of Kodiak crab fisheries are crucial to maintaining the population of these iconic creatures. Fishing regulations and quotas are enforced to prevent overfishing and protect the long-term viability of the species. The Alaskan crab fishery is considered one of the most well-managed and sustainable fisheries in the world.

When purchasing Kodiak crab, it is essential to ensure that it comes from a reputable and sustainable source. Look for labels or certifications, such as the Marine Stewardship Council (MSC) logo, which guarantees the sustainability of the seafood product.

There are various ways to prepare and enjoy Kodiak crab. Some popular cooking methods include steaming, boiling, grilling, or baking. The meat can be used in a wide range of recipes, such as crab legs with butter, crab bisque, or crab-stuffed mushrooms. The versatility of Kodiak crab makes it a favorite among seafood lovers.
